Have you been toying with the idea of praying for others? If so, here’s today’s Holy Nougat™️

“I can assure you that he prays hard for you and also for the believers in Laodicea and Hierapolis.” Colossians‬ ‭4:13‬ ‭NLT‬‬

Wouldn’t it be awesome to be known for our diligence as intercessors? Just imagine, we are known for our sweet communion with the Lord; and not for ourselves, but for others. I admit, I am nowhere as diligent as I used to be; and am working on it. Nevertheless a life of prayer is worthwhile living.

Many of us are keen on other ministries, as well we can. The role of an intercession, though scarcely noticed, is critical to the success of any ministry. For, if God is not at central to any ministry, it is a service club or a performance; having the wrong kind of soul.

Furthermore, in the Gospels, Jesus taught on prayer with some regularity; and his lifestyle shows the need for extending prayer beyond our own needs. For, He prayed – fasted actually – prior to beginning His ministry, selecting the disciples and facing the Cross. He was caught praying by the disciples, who noticed something different about His approach to God. And on the Cross, one declaration revealed Jesus’ intimacy with God; and THREE were passionate prayers, for Himself and us.

Prayer is crucial for the strength of the believer.

We pray for others out of our compassion, born of the recognition that we thrive in community, and not as well on our own. Today, we recognize that the intercessor (aka prayer warrior) was earnest in his prayers for other Christians. His main focus seemed to be the house churches in Colossi, Laodicia and Hierapolis. Perhaps they were hot spots of some kind, or new church starts. We have many of both all around the world. Are we covering them in our prayers? Seriously covering.

There are spaces and people in our own families, churches, communities, countries and/or regions parched for want of spiritual impact. There are conflict zones where lives are snuffed daily and anarchy reigns. There are diseases and killer viruses that are decimating populations.

It is time to pray.

Can God count on as an intercessor?
